Equal Opportunity

Council believes that its employees are entitled to be treated on the basis of their abilities and merit, and to work in a safe, productive and congenial environment where they are treated fairly and equitably and are not subject to harassment, discrimination, bullying or occupational violence of any kind.

An education program continues to be held for Council staff providing them with full details of Council's Equal Opportunity Policy and Guidelines, Harassment Policy and Guidelines and Bullying and Occupational Violence. These information programs provide staff with clarification on what are the grounds of discrimination, what constitutes discrimination and harassment, employee and employer responsibilities and processes within Council for dealing with these issues. Training of staff in the Selection Interview Techniques has also reinforced our requirement for merit-based selection.

All new staff members are provided with full details of the Equal Opportunity, Harassment and Bullying and Occupational Violence policy, guidelines and processes through the Council's Induction Program.
Training And Development

A comprehensive corporate training program continued which provided staff with the ability to upgrade and enhance skills and knowledge. Programs included Customer Service, Induction, Dealing with Conflict, Communication Skills, Leadership Introduction, Disability Awareness and Selection Interviewing Skills.

Following on from our corporate training program, staff have been encouraged to enrol in further tertiary studies, and support has been provided to these staff members. Courses undertaken include Bachelor of Applied Science (Built Environment), Holmesglen TAFE, Graduate Diploma of Planning, Deakin University, Masters of Management, Monash University, Bachelor of Teaching (Early Childhood Education), University of Ballarat, Diploma of Engineering, Box Hill TAFE and Certificate IV in Occupational Health and Safety, University of Ballarat.

Occupational Health and Safety training continued for key staff across Council. A Professional Boundaries course was conducted for Residential Care staff.

Home and Community Care continued its very successful recruitment program for people to undertake Certificate III in Home and Community Care at Holmesglen TAFE while working as General Carers.

A further 12 staff were employed during the year under this program. This is now our major recruitment method to replace staff that retire or resign.
